WebSep 5, 2024 · The moment capacity of the welds is the strength of the weld metal multiplied by the section modulus of the weld throat about the axis of rotation, generally the neutral axis of the weld perpendicular to the beam. WebThe AISC design guide on column strengthening / stiffening recommends a maximum b/t ratio for the doubler plates to prevent local bucking of the doubler plate under applied shear stress. For the Canadian code, RISAConnection uses an h/t ratio of 1014/sqrt (F y) for this maximum ratio. This is based on the h/t limits given in clause 13.4.1.1.
